jOOQ代表Java Object Oriented Querying。 jOOQ在流畅,直观的DSL中有效地结合了复杂的SQL,类型安全,源代码生成,活动记录,存储过程,高级数据类型和Java。
Jooq - 如何使用嵌套记录(行)和临时转换查询可空 1:1 关系
将 jooq 与嵌套记录一起使用时(请参阅:https://www.jooq.org/doc/latest/manual/sql-building/column-expressions/nested-records/)和临时转换(请参阅:https ://www.jooq.org/doc/latest/manual/...
Jooq Records.Mapping 在多个构造函数的情况下找不到构造函数
当使用 Jooq-Codegenerator 创建的“Pojo”类时,它们(可能)包含多个构造函数(默认构造函数、接口构造函数、字段构造函数)。例如: 噗...
使用 SelectWhereStep 构建动态查询时未调用 JOOQ 自定义数据类型转换器/绑定
我有一个用于 java 布尔字段的自定义数据类型转换器,它将与 Oracle 中的 VARCHAR2 (6) 列匹配,并存储在数据库文本“false”或“true”中 公开课
我对以下示例没有问题: 记录 ProductItem(Long ProductId, BigDecimal 价格) { } 列表项目= dsl().select( 产品.产品ID, 产品价格...
我有以下 DTO: 产品DTO 用户DTO 用户角色DTO: 我需要获取产品列表,每个产品都有一个字段“creatorId”(NULLABLE)。 对于creatorId,我需要f...
我正在运行jOOQ生成工具(jdk11+试用版),它为每个表生成正确的Java类,但是该包包含数据库名称和模式。我想省略...
在 MySQL/MariaDB 中我尝试做类似的事情: ctx.alterTable("my_table") .addColumn("id", SQLDataType.BIGINT.identity(true)) 。执行(); ctx.alterTable("my_table&quo...
是否可以在运行时而不是构建时使用 jooq 以编程方式初始化测试容器中的数据库,或者我是否必须执行 DDL 文件?
我正在尝试使用jooq-codegen-gradle插件通过逆向工程sql文件(Flyway迁移文件)来生成jooq代码。这就是我的 build.gradle.kts 文件(仅相关部分)的外观...
使用 SelectWhereStep 构建动态查询时未调用 JOOQ 自定义数据类型转换器
我有一个用于 Oracle DB 中布尔值的自定义数据类型转换器: 公共类 CustomBooleanConverter 实现 Converter{ @覆盖 公共布尔值 from(String s...
使用 Kotlin JOOQ 和 MySQL 进行嵌套多重集
我在为两层嵌套集合构造正确的查询时遇到问题 - 数据形状为 JSON... [ { "name": "我的超级区", “地区&
GraalVM / SpringBoot3 / Maven / Jooq:在数据库保存时“无法构造新记录”
我正在尝试将一个小项目移动到本机构建。在 Win10 上,我可以构建一个 exe,没有错误,应用程序正在启动,现在我可以使用 ctx.insertInto() 插入,但我有大量的 ctx.newRecord() ...
使用r2dbc和jOOQ时事务回滚似乎不起作用 演示库 暂停乐趣插入(id:字符串){ 如果(id==“b”){ 抛出 RuntimeException("错误同时
将SpringBoot Jooq应用部署到wildfly不会加载Jooq类
你好,我正在尝试创建一个工作流引擎 项目结构如下 └── 工作流引擎/ ├── 工作流引擎服务器/ │ ├── 源代码 │ └── pom.xml ├── 工作流引擎数据/ ...
如何使用 JOOQ 编写 where 子句,过滤 JSON 数组内 JSON 对象中的特定 JSON 属性?
我的 PostgreSQL 数据库的名为 services 的 JSONB 列中有此结构: [ { “状态”:“活动”, }, ] 我...
我们可以使用模拟框架进行负载测试还是应该创建接口将虚拟数据注入到类中?
我有一个服务“S”,它具有生成报告并下载报告的逻辑。它是用spring-boot和java编写的。这是由另一个系统“B”消耗的,该系统的数据库“C”中的数据
如何配置 JOOQ 传递十六进制字符串而不是八进制以在 PostgreSQL 中插入 bytea 列?
我们正在使用JOOQ将记录插入到带有bytea列的postgresql表中。 我们发送的字节数组大约为 150Mb,我们从 Postgresql 服务器收到错误: 错误:内存无效...
Kotlin 项目中 jooq-codegen-gradle 的配置
我已经修改了文档,但文档相对不清楚如何将生成的 JOOQ 文件作为其项目的一部分。生成文件时,我发现了该项目...
Jooq 会强制转换我的 UUID,即使它已经是 uuid 类型,为什么?
如果不存在则创建表事件 ( id UUID 不为空, type_id UUID, 发生时间为时区不为空的时间戳, 主键(id) ); 乔德代码: 瓦尔
我正在使用 jooq-codegen 从我的数据库模式生成 Java 类,但我遇到了表名前缀的问题。例如,名为 t_user 的表最终生成一个名为...